Anti-Leishmanial and Immunomodulatory Effects of Epigallocatechin 3-O-Gallate on Leishmania tropica: Apoptosis and Gene Expression Profiling

Background: pentavalent antimonials such as meglumine antimoniate (ma, glucantime), are the first-line treatment against leishmaniasis, but at present, they have basically lost their efficacy. this study was aimed to explore epigallocatechin 3-o-gallate (egcg), alone or in combination with ma against leishmania tropica stages. methods: all experiments were carried out in triplicate using colorimetric assay, macrophage model, flow cytometry and quantitative real-time pcr. this experimental study was carried out in 2017 in leishmaniasis research center, kerman university of medical sciences, kerman, iran. results: promastigotes and amastigotes were more susceptible to egcg than ma alone, but the effect was more profound when used in combination. egcg exhibited high antioxidant level with a remarkable potential to induce apoptosis. furthermore, the results showed that the level of gene expression pertaining to th-1 was significantly up-regulated (p<0.001). conclusion: egcg demonstrated a potent anti-leishmanial effect alone and more enhanced lethal activity in combination. the principal mode of action entails the stimulation of a synergistic response and up-regulation of the immunomodulatory role towards th-1 response against l. tropica.
